  1. Learn a song by ear (without sheet music)
  2. Play a holiday song for your family on your instrument
  3. Always practice with the best tone possible
  4. Play 5 minutes of therhythm trainer.com
  5. Play concert Eb scale in eighth notes
  6. Play concert Eb scale in half notes (higher notes)
  7. Play 10 longtones for 10+ seconds
  8. Play a porch concert for your neighbors
  9. Listen to Cloud Dancing by Richard Saucedo 4 times
  10. Facetime/video call a friend and practice together for 15 minutes
  11. do 100 note naming questions at music theory.net
  12. Learn a song from your favorite video game/movie
  13. Learn m.25-33 of Cloud Dancing
  14. Practice with a tuner
  15. Watch a video lesson from beginning band boot camp
  16. Practice with a metronome
  17. Learn the chromatic scale in whole notes
  18. Listen to a professional who plays your instrument 3 times
  19. Learn a duet with a friend
  20. Practice anything on 5 different days (10 mins minumum)
  21. Play a mini-concert for your family
  22. Play through 3 pages in your yellow band book (after page 13)
  23. Play 5 minutes of therhythm trainer.com for 5 days in a row
  24. Tune your instrument before every practice session
